Nuclear power plants (NPPs) are used extensively as base load sources of electricity as this is the technically simplest mode of operation. However, for countries including the UK with a desire to increase renewable energy sources to create energy mix, the question arises as to whether the NPPs can be operated in a load-following mode. One can indeed assume that because of frequent load-following cycles, the capability to accurately predict the lifetime under creep-fatigue interaction is required. Our theoretical analysis showed that accelerated cavity nucleation occurred during creep dwells and this causes the life reduction. Neutron diffraction measurement will be used to validate the theoretical model prediction. The experiment-validated model will provide important data to support the life prediction of NPPs operating in a load-following mode on a regular basis.
